Place the minced beef in a large bowl with the egg yolks, garlic powder, oyster sauce, white bread crumbs and the seasoning.
Kneed the mixture together for 2 Minutes until well combined.
Divide the beef into 4 equal sized pieces. If you have a burger press then make burgers as your press describes, alternatively use a chefs ring or make a ball shape and flatten gently with the palm of your hand.
Ideally the burger will be 1/2 inch thick , fry on both sides until lightly charred and cooked through. On the final turn place the sliced cheddar on top to melt.
Warm the burger buns or lightly toast if you choose to, place a couple of crispy lettuce leaves then the burger followed by a slice of tomato and then the most important part a good dollop of the burger relish. Get stuck in and let us know if you agree how good it is.
